#815BAE Hex Color Code

#815BAE

The Hexadecimal Color #815BAE is a contrast shade of Slate Blue. #815BAE RGB value is rgb(129, 91, 174). RGB Color Model of #815BAE consists of 50% red, 35% green and 68% blue. HSL color Mode of #815BAE has 267°(degrees) Hue, 34% Saturation and 52% Lightness. #815BAE color has an wavelength of 451.88889n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#815BAE is #9966CC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#815BAE is #85A. The Closest Color to #815BAE is #6A5ACD. Official Name of #815BAE Hex Code is Trendy Pink.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#815BAE is 26 Cyan 48 Magenta 0 Yellow 32 Black and #815BAE CMY is 26, 48,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#815BAE is hsl(267,34,52,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(267, 48, 68).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#815BAE is 20.43, 15.21, 41.89.
Hex8 Value of #815BAE is #815BAEFF. Decimal Value of #815BAE is 8477614 and Octal Value of #815BAE is 40255656. Binary Value of #815BAE is 10000001, 1011011, 10101110 and Android of #815BAE is 4286667694 / 0xff815bae.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#815BAE is 0.264, 0.196, 0.196 and YIQ Color Space of #815BAE is 111.824, -4.0237, 33.8666.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#815BAE is 14.7, 11.7, 41.46.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#815BAE is 45.92, 32.61, -38.7.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#815BAE is 45.92, 12.25, -61.24.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#815BAE is 45.92, 50.61, 310.12. Hunter Lab variable of #815BAE is 39.0, 25.26, -36.38.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#815BAE

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
